The appropriate firm will enter each bench warrant released on a personal guaranty bound felony case right into the nationwide warrant system (National Criminal activity Info Facility (NCIC). Bail bond indemnitor is the co-signer for the bail bond. The indemnitor is accountable for seeing that all premiums are spent for an accused's bail bond.






If the situation continues for longer than a year, added premiums will certainly schedule and accumulated for every year the instance takes place. Bail bond premiums are not refundable, as they are made use of for the bail representative's expenses, and so on. The indemnitor is likewise in charge of added costs incurred by the bond agent in the deal of a bail bond, such as long range calls, traveling, etc.

It is best to call the bail bond business when the bail bond is vindicated by the court, for the proper return of any kind of collateral promised and to confirm that the bond is vindicated. In case of loss, the indemnitor is liable up until the full quantity of the bail has actually been paid, plus any kind of costs incurred, or until the court vindicates the bond.


Recognizing how a bail bond works is necessary. The person is detained and scheduled, followed by engaging the bail bond representative, that aids throughout the bail hearing.

After an arrest, the individual is taken right into safekeeping and undergoes a scheduling phase, where they supply personal details, and the costs are recorded. The court then sets a bond quantity that the accused need to pay to be released while awaiting their court appearance. This cash bail might be based on basic offenses in a jailhouse bail timetable or determined during a court hearing.


You will certainly require to fill in an application and supply thorough individual and financial information, perhaps including a co-signer's information. After accepting a partial settlement, the bail bond company will certainly pay the sum total to the court, often with support from a guaranty company. This process can take anywhere from 30 minutes to numerous hours, depending upon the complexity of the case.

Each bonding office will certainly have their very own criteria but also for one of the most part you can expect them to accept various forms of bond security. Some instances of collateral consist of Property, Mobile Houses, Cars, Motorcycles and Cash money. Security is supplied in location of or along with bail money in order to safeguard the launch of the individual that has been jailed.


Collateral can come in many types; it can be your home or other assets of a particular provided worth. If you are supplying your home, vehicle or various other huge residential or commercial property items as collateral, the court or bond agent will typically have you place the deed or pink slip in their trust fund.


The majority of the moment bond collateral takes the type of building. If the court is accumulating on a property-based bond collateral as a result of a failing to show up in court, it commonly involves the seizure and sale of the individual's home. Home bond takes weeks to accumulate on, and equity in the estate being marketed must be established to equate to at least 150% of what is owed the court.
